Transaction 40250d9657e6d77d6f2bf84b636ac6f4c4aee1f69cd683b1d8e364dfa841ca06

1 Input
1 Outputs
  • 40250d9657e6d77d6f2bf84b636ac6f4c4aee1f69cd683b1d8e364dfa841ca06:0
  • value  66289873
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G